Mark is a partner based in our London office. Mark is co-head of the London Remuneration & Incentives team, who focuses on employee incentives and remuneration, advising both listed and private companies. Mark advises on the establishment, operation and tax implications of a variety of cash and share-based incentive arrangements. He also advises on the incentives aspects of corporate actions, including takeovers, IPOs, schemes of arrangement, rights issues and demergers. Mark also advises on the remuneration aspects of executive recruitments and terminations and is a professional in advising financial institutions, including banks and asset managers, on compliance with remuneration regulations. Mark joined the firm as a trainee in 1998, qualified in 2000 and became a Partner in 2008. Mark is a member of the Share Plan Lawyers Group, and a member of its Tax Committee. Mark is the author of Employee Share Schemes published by Bloomsbury Professional, one of the leading texts on the subject. He is the joint contributor on employee incentives in Revenue Law: Principles and Practice (pub. Bloomsbury) and co-author of Chambers and Partners' Venture Capital 2024.
